The article seems to think that a young woman shouldn't be portrayed as going after an older, powerful, confident male when, as far as anthropology is concerned, this is fairly common behavior. Case in point: all of Trump's wives, Monica Lewinsky or any of these: http://m.ranker.com/list/famous-women-who-married-older-men/celebrity-lists?var=13&utm_expid=16418821-229.FLH4oJT1R8meAGH-jDdxAQ.12

Does it change the story of Batgirl and Batman? Quite possibly. But what I find really interesting is no one talks about what happens to Barbara Gordon in The Killing Joke. Not only is she shot and crippled, but it's alluded to that she's raped by the the Joker. Will that be in this cartoon movie? Or did the WB just decide to gloss over that part?

The Killing Joke was a particularly dark time for Batman and cemented the Joker as one of the most sadistic villainous characters in comic books for all time.
